Meaning & Etymology
Mother of the nation
Mother of the nation
Etymology
From the isiZulu words noma (mother) and langa (nation).
Linguistic family: Niger-Congo > Atlantic-Congo > Volta-Congo > Benue-Congo > Bantoid > Southern Bantoid > Bantu > Southern Bantu > Nguni
Cultural context
The name is often given to girls who are expected to have a significant role in society.
Symbolism
Represents leadership and societal responsibility.
